Veteran radio presenter - William Des Bordes, otherwise known as Lovin Cee has resigned from Fox FM.

The ace broadcaster reportedly tendered in his resignation letter over lack of gratitude from his employers.

He is also reported to have quit the Kumasi based radio station due to jealousy and unprofessionalism from co-workers.

Lovin Cee who has worked with the media outfit for a number years before his unexpected exit, was the host of the late afternoon show dubbed 'Fox Rush Hour'.

Prior to joining Fox FM, Lovin Cee worked with a number of reputable media houses including Kapital Radio and Angel FM.
